APPLICATION GUIDELINES
Eligibility
The Kenneth Cole Community Engagement Program is open to sophomores and juniors in Columbia Engineering and Columbia College. The program is designed for students who are willing to devote a considerable amount of energy and reflection to the process of community building.
If accepted into the program, students will be required to register for a credit-bearing course entitled "Community Engagement and Community Building: Strengthening Communities to Advance Social Change" in the Spring semester, as well as participate in the summer living-learning experience. Kenneth Cole Fellows will receive a summer stipend of $3000 in addition to on-campus housing for the duration of the internship (approximately 11 weeks from early June to mid-August). Students are responsible for their own housing for the weeks before and after the internship. Please note that Fellows are not permitted to hold additional employment during the course of the summer internship. Students receiving financial aid will have their summer work contribution waived if accepted into this program.
Application Requirements
In order to apply for the program, students must submit the following materials:
- A completed application form;
- A personal statement of interest;
- A one-page resume; and
- An undergraduate transcript (unofficial copies are acceptable).
Selection Process
The selection committee will review applications while focusing on the following:
- Academic performance, particularly with regard to the required courses for the program;
- A personal statement of interest;
- Recommendation from instructors; and
- The ability and committment to complete the program
The personal statement of interest should consist of 500-750 words and describe your interest in the program and community engagement; how you would connect your academic experience to your participation in this program; what you hope to gain from this experience, particularly with regard to your future endeavors and career plans; and what you can contribute to the team of Kenneth Cole Fellows.
